- Как ускорить загрузку сайта в эпоху AR: секреты высокой скорости и лучшие практики
- Почему важна скорость загрузки в AR-проектах?
- Основные факторы, влияющие на скорость загрузки AR-контента
- Лучшие практики ускорения загрузки AR-контента
- Примеры успешных решений и кейсы по ускорению AR
- Кейс 1: Магазин мебели использует оптимизированные 3D-модели
- Кейс 2: Э-коммерс платформа внедряет ленивую загрузку и кэширование
- Кейс 3: Образовательное приложение использует WebAssembly
- Вопрос к статье и его ответ
Как ускорить загрузку сайта в эпоху AR: секреты высокой скорости и лучшие практики
В современном мире технология дополненной реальности (AR) становится неотъемлемой частью множества приложений и веб-сервисов. Ведущие компании используют AR для повышения вовлеченности пользователей, улучшения пользовательского опыта и повышения конверсии. Однако, чтобы обеспечить корректную работу AR-контента, особенно в мобильных приложениях и на веб-платформах, критически важна скорость загрузки страниц и ресурсов. Чем быстрее пользователь загружает и начинает взаимодействовать с AR-контентом, тем выше вероятность удержания аудитории и достижения бизнес-целей.
Ни для кого не секрет, что задержки при загрузке могут в значительной степени снизить эффективность AR-решений, привести к разочарованию пользователей и даже к потере потенциальных клиентов. Именно поэтому в нашей статье мы разберемся, почему важна скорость загрузки в AR, какие факторы на нее влияют и как оптимизировать ресурсы для быстрого и беспрепятственного внедрения дополненной реальности.
Почему важна скорость загрузки в AR-проектах?
Понижение задержек, ключ к успешной реализации AR. Пользователи ожидают мгновенной реакции и безупречной работы приложений, использующих AR. В противном случае, они могут просто уйти, не дождавшись полной загрузки контента. Для AR особенно важна скорость, поскольку:
- Немедленное взаимодействие: Чем быстрее стартует AR, тем быстрее можно предложить пользователю захватывающий опыт.
- Удержание аудитории: Мгновенная загрузка способствует положительному впечатлению и лояльности.
- Оптимизация конверсии: Быстрое реагирование повышает шансы на выполнение целевых действий, покупки, регистрации, оставления отзывов.
- Снижение отказывых показателей: Задержки более 3 секунд в большинстве случаев ведут к уходу посетителя с сайта или приложения.
Особенно это актуально для мобильных устройств и веб-страниц, где скорости сети могут значительно варьироваться. Тогда как пользователь ожидает мгновенной реакции, при задержках даже в пределах секунды шанс потерять его существенно возрастает.
Основные факторы, влияющие на скорость загрузки AR-контента
Разобравшись в важности скорости, важно понять, что на нее влияет множество факторов. Они могут быть как внутренними, связанными с архитектурой вашего сайта или приложения, так и внешними — условиями сети или характеристиками устройства пользователя. Ниже приведена таблица, иллюстрирующая ключевые факторы:
| Фактор | Описание | Влияние на скорость |
|---|---|---|
| Размер ресурсов | Объем изображений, 3D-моделей, скриптов и других медиафайлов. | Чем больше размер, тем дольше загружается контент. |
| Качество и оптимизация медиа | Использование сжатых и оптимизированных изображений и моделей. | Значительное сокращение времени загрузки. |
| Сетевая инфраструктура | Скорость соединения, задержки, пропускная способность. | Определяет, как быстро ресурс передается клиенту. |
| Хостинг и CDN | Географическая удаленность серверов и использование CDN. | Меньшие задержки и более быстрая загрузка. |
| Оптимизация кода | Минификация, сокращение скриптов и использование современных стандартов. | Обеспечивает более быструю обработку и рендеринг. |
| Использование WebAssembly | Для тяжелых вычислений и графики. | Современное решение для повышения скорости загрузки AR-контента. |
Все эти факторы требуют пристального внимания, поскольку их комбинация определяет конечную скорость загрузки и качество взаимодействия пользователя с AR-контентом.
Лучшие практики ускорения загрузки AR-контента
Итак, что же нужно делать, чтобы ускорить загрузку AR и обеспечить комфортное взаимодействие для пользователей? Ниже мы собрали проверенные методы и рекомендации.
- Минификация и сжатие ресурсов: используйте инструменты для минификации CSS, JavaScript и изображений (например, WebP, AVIF). Это позволит значительно снизить вес файлов без потери качества.
- Использование CDN: распространяйте контент через сеть доставки контента, чтобы уменьшить задержки и ускорить загрузку вне зависимости от геолокации пользователя.
- Оптимизация 3D-моделей: используйте форматы GLTF или USDZ, которые хорошо подходят для мобильных устройств и ускоряют рендеринг.
- Ленивая загрузка (Lazy Loading): по мере необходимости загружайте ресурсы, вместо одновременной загрузки всего контента при открытии страницы.
- Использование WebAssembly: для выполнения тяжелых вычислений и обработки графики используйте WebAssembly, что значительно повышает производительность.
- Кэширование данных: правильно настройте кэширование ресурсов, чтобы при повторных посещениях загрузка была мгновенной.
- Параллельная загрузка ресурсов: используйте асинхронные скрипты и мультипоточность там, где возможно.
- Оптимизация сетевых соединений: использование HTTP/2 или HTTP/3 — современные протоколы, повышающие скорость передачи данных.
- Мониторинг и тестирование: постоянно отслеживайте показатели скорости загрузки и оптимизируйте слабые места.
- Многоуровневое тестирование: проверяйте работу AR на различных устройствах и в разных условиях сети, чтобы выявлять узкие места и оптимизировать их.
Комбинирование всех этих подходов поможет создать максимально быстрый и отзывчивый AR-контент, который не отпугнет пользователей своими задержками и обеспечит высокий уровень вовлеченности.
Примеры успешных решений и кейсы по ускорению AR
Многие компании уже реализовали практические решения по ускорению загрузки AR, что позволило им значительно повысить показатели вовлеченности и пользовательского опыта. Ниже приведены несколько типичных кейсов и решений.
Кейс 1: Магазин мебели использует оптимизированные 3D-модели
Магазин мебели внедрил форматы GLTF и использует CDN для доставки AR-моделей. В результате время загрузки снизилось с 4 секунд до 1 секунды, а конверсия по взаимодействию с AR увеличилась на 35%.
Кейс 2: Э-коммерс платформа внедряет ленивую загрузку и кэширование
На сайте добавили асинхронную загрузку изображений и скриптов, а также кэширование ресурсов. Время первой загрузки снизилось примерно вдвое, и спад отказов при использовании AR сократился на 20%.
Кейс 3: Образовательное приложение использует WebAssembly
Для обработки сложной графики и вычислений применено WebAssembly, что позволило обеспечить плавное функционирование AR даже на бюджетных устройствах и снизить задержки до минимальных значений.
Для достижения максимальных результатов стоит уделять внимание оптимизации ресурсов, использованию современных технологий и постоянному мониторингу работы системы. Только так можно обеспечить действительно быстрый, удобный и увлекательный AR-контент, который оставит у пользователя только положительные впечатления.
Вопрос к статье и его ответ
Как быстро должна загружаться AR-контент, чтобы обеспечить высокий пользовательский опыт?
Оптимальный срок загрузки AR-контента — не более 1-2 секунд. Исследования показывают, что после 2-3 секунд задержки большинство пользователей начинают терять интерес и уходят, что негативно сказывается на вовлеченности и конверсиях. Поэтому важно стремиться к минимизации времени загрузки и обеспечить плавное и своевременное взаимодействие с AR.
Подробнее
| ускорение AR | оптимизация загрузки сайта | WebAssembly для AR | использование CDN | WebP и AVIF |
| ускорение 3D моделей | lazy loading AR | скорость интернет-соединения | оптимизация кодов JS и CSS | кэширование ресурсов |
| лучшие практики AR | кейсы ускорения AR | оптимизация моделей для AR | скорость загрузки сайта | мониторинг производительности |
